Should every oneshot end in a climatic fight? by Professional_Staff29 in DMAcademy

[–]DapperDungeonMaster 3 points4 points  (0 children)

The generic and easy answer here is to do what you and your group find to be fun. If the bosses are fun for you to run and your group enjoys it why not go with a boss. However in my opinion there are also many other ways to go about this if you are wanting for something new, here are a few ideas:

  • They have to escape form some dangerous place, maybe a crumbling ruin or a magical disaster. To escape they are running against the clock and have to make split second decisions or solve a kind of puzzle that is blocking them.
  • If you enjoy a more intruige or roleplay focused game maybe they have to convince someone to do something or repair a ruined relationship (i. e repair the relationship of a nobleman and his estranged son in order to stop a brewing conflict.)
  • If you are big into puzzles maybe the end is a particularly challenging puzzle which leads to a resolution to the plot
  • Maybe leave the door open at the end if they want to defeat a moraly gray character or if they want to try and work with him to help the "bad guy" become a better person

These are a few off the top of my head will add more if I think of something.

The most important thing is to do what will be fun for you and the group :)

First try at setting up a game of 5e by gaxine in DnD

[–]DapperDungeonMaster 0 points1 point  (0 children)

happy to hear that you want to give it a go. I would recommend starting off no higher than lvl 3 especially with new players, otherwise you run the risk of overwhelming them. Regarding how they find the dungeon didn't you say a villager would lead them there? I personaly think that a side puzzle with extra loot is cool, it gives them more of a sense of freedom and will help new players understand that dnd isnt just a linear "go kill the bad guy" game. That is also in my mind the most important advice for a new group. Be open to your players trying vreative things you hadnt considered yet, flex your improv muscles and roll with it. the other big tip is to not make the game to rulea heavy, im sure some will disagree with me on this but I recommend being ok with small rules errors. Better for the dm to make up something on the spot and correct it for the next session than to pause the game and spend 15min in the rulebook. And of course most importantly have tons of fun.
